[11:54:31] <vm03> привет всем!
[13:42:49] <zombah> добрый день всем
[14:11:08] <vm03> zombah, привет!
[15:11:31] <zombah> stuw: ты тут?
[15:11:39] <zombah> stuw: я протестил наконец 8)
[15:11:52] <stuw> zombah: ну чу как? :)
[15:11:57] <zombah> stuw: появились новые input девайсы NVEC bla bla
[15:12:04] <zombah> stuw: но ивентов от них нет 8)
[15:12:15] <stuw> логи тогда нужны )
[15:12:19] <stuw> dmesg
[15:12:23] <zombah> счас пять сек
[15:13:26] <zombah> stuw: но по закрытию крышки теперь в сон уходит ок!
[15:13:45] <zombah> stuw: тоесть ивент от крышки норм обрабатывается
[15:14:05] <stuw> уже что-то
[15:15:45] <zombah> root@android:/ # getevent
[15:15:48] <zombah> add device 1: /dev/input/event8
[15:15:51] <zombah> name: "Android Power Button"
[15:15:53] <zombah> add device 2: /dev/input/event7
[15:15:56] <zombah> name: "USB Camera"
[15:15:58] <zombah> could not get driver version for /dev/input/mice, Not a typewriter
[15:16:01] <zombah> could not get driver version for /dev/input/mouse0, Not a typewriter
[15:16:03] <zombah> add device 3: /dev/input/event5
[15:16:06] <zombah> name: "ETPS/2 Elantech Touchpad"
[15:16:08] <zombah> add device 4: /dev/input/event3
[15:16:11] <zombah> name: "nvec keyboard"
[15:16:13] <zombah> add device 5: /dev/input/event2
[15:16:16] <zombah> name: "NVEC lid switch button"
[15:16:18] <zombah> add device 6: /dev/input/event1
[15:16:21] <zombah> name: "NVEC power button"
[15:16:24] <zombah> add device 7: /dev/input/event0
[15:16:26] <zombah> name: "NVEC sleep button"
[15:16:29] <zombah> add device 8: /dev/input/event6
[15:16:31] <zombah> name: "gpio-keys"
[15:16:34] <zombah> add device 9: /dev/input/event4
[15:16:36] <zombah> name: "Compal PAZ00 Headset Jack"
[15:28:33] <stuw> блин, я шляпа :)
[15:28:48] <stuw> имя кривое забубенил в новый девайс
[15:36:44] <stuw> zombah: лови еще патч )
[15:37:00] <zombah> stuw: спасибо
[15:45:25] <stuw> zombah: кстати, я тут подсмотрел интересную идею - можно на короткое нажатие кнопки питания слать KEY_POWER, а на длинное - KEY_SLEEP. Или наоборот.
[15:45:35] <stuw> Тогда их можно будет хендлить по-разному
[15:46:09] <stuw> типа быстро нажал - тошка в сон ушла, подержал - диалог выключения
[15:46:23] <zombah> stuw: надо наоборот на коротки SLEEP, на длинные POWER. Вроде так фреймворк андроид их ждет
[15:46:56] <stuw> сейчас длинное работает а короткое нет ?
[15:47:12] <zombah> stuw: да по короткому в логах тишина
[15:55:22] <stuw> zombah: а ты не помнишь, в какой ветке у нас оба события работали ?
[15:55:30] <stuw> долгое и короткое
[16:22:02] <zombah> stuw: оба работали только на стоке
[16:22:14] <zombah> stuw: в 3.1 только короткое
[16:24:10] <stuw> zombah: можно попробовать включить абсолютно ВСЕ события :)
[16:24:17] <stuw> и посмотреть, что получится
[16:24:24] <zombah> stuw: тема
[16:25:17] <stuw> zombah: лови тогда патч )
[16:26:32] <stuw> в nvec.c включаются биты 1 и 15, в nvec_event 1 и 7. 7 и 15 вроде кнопка питания, но вот что-то работает только длинное нажатие.
[16:26:46] <stuw> вобщем я все врубил, но не знаю, что из этого выйдет :)
[16:27:01] <stuw> надо проверять
[16:27:22] <zombah> затестим и видно будет
[16:32:02] <stuw> "в 3.1 только короткое" - о, так оно у нас и не пашет же.
[22:18:07] <zombah> stuw_: вывалило меню по короткому нажатию потом ушло в слип и теперь вывести из него не могу 8)
[22:18:57] <zombah> stuw_: а по долгому только в дмесг ивент
[22:19:33] <zombah> так или powerbtn чтот перехватил
[22:19:43] <zombah> счас надо его отрубить нафиг пока
[22:20:52] <zombah> digetx протестил у себя на a500 с 128мб под графигу у него тоже глюки...надо размер дырки увеличивать 8(
[22:24:44] <zombah> да точно имя теперь верное и он перехватывает устройство
[22:24:52] <zombah> счас я его выкорчую
[22:58:57] <stuw_> ок, кидай логи и описание
[22:59:15] <stuw_> потом надо будет минимизировать включение и сделать по-человечески
[23:02:04] <zombah> счас я выключу powerbtnd и твой последний патч тоже подцеплю и уже так соберу логи
[23:07:33] <stuw_> можешь в ядре выключить
[23:08:19] <stuw_> главное, что и короткое и длинное нажатия работают. Дальше уже можно разобраться :)